You may or may not know at this time that Hugo “El Pollo (The Chicken)” Carvajal, former head of Venezuela’s General Directorate of Military Counterintelligence (DGCIM) is currently in federal prison awaiting sentencing for drug trafficking charges. If you depend on the Elitist Media for news coverage, you DEFINITELY don’t know that he just published a bombshell allocution that lays out the Maduro regime’s long campaign against the United States.

Carvajal’s open letter to President Donald Trump was published in The Dallas Express and picked up by other outlets. Per DX :

The Dallas Express has obtained an explosive letter addressed to President Donald Trump from Hugo Carvajal Barrios — the former Director of Military Intelligence for Venezuela and once one of the most powerful figures inside the governments of Hugo Chávez and Nicolás Maduro.

The letter, shared exclusively with DX by Carvajal’s attorney, Robert Feitel — a former senior Justice Department prosecutor — marks the first time the retired Major General has put these warnings on the record since pleading guilty earlier this year in a U.S. federal narco-terrorism case.

Carvajal — extradited from Spain after a lengthy international manhunt — says he is writing “to atone” and to alert Americans to what he describes as a coordinated, state-directed campaign targeting the United States.

The letter lays out the different ways in which the Chavista regime, under auspices of the Cuban dictatorship, set out to flood the United States with drugs, illegal immigrant criminals, and spies, while threatening the nation’s election integrity. And you’d think that the contents of this letter are important to know in the midst of an ongoing military operation in the southern Caribbean.

Carvajal states he was present at the inception of the Cartel of the Suns, created at the behest of the Cuban regime (truly the head of the snake in our hemisphere) for the purpose of weaponizing drugs against the United States. He writes:

The drugs that reached your cities through new routes were not accidents of corruption nor just the work of independent traffickers; they were deliberate policies coordinated by the Venezuelan regime against the United States.

This plan was suggested by the Cuban regime to Chávez in the mid-2000s and has been successfully executed with help from FARC, ELN, Cuban operatives, and Hezbollah. The regime has provided weapons, passports, and impunity for these terrorist organizations to operate freely from Venezuela against the United States.

SATCHA PRETTO: And reactions are pouring in to the public letter from Venezuela's former military intelligence chief, Hugo Carvajal, to President Donald Trump. In the letter, Carvajal, also known as "El Pollo" (The Chicken), reveals that it is true that Nicolás Maduro's regime has transformed Venezuela into a narco-terrorist organization that uses cocaine as a weapon and collaborates with groups such as the FARC (the Marxist Revolutionary Armed Forces of Colombia), the ELN (Colombia’s Marxist National Liberation Army), Cuban intelligence, and Hezbollah. He also states that it has infiltrated U.S. institutions for two decades and facilitated the expansion of criminal networks like the Tren de Aragua. The former Venezuelan general pleaded guilty this year in a U.S. federal court to narco-terrorism charges.

NICOLE SUÁREZ: Well, the Dallas Express obtained a copy of the letter that Hugo "El Pollo" Carvajal sent to President Trump, in which he discusses the so-called Cartel of the Suns. Look, part of what he wrote was, "I was a personal witness." The purpose of this organization, now known as the Cartel of the Suns, is to use drugs as a weapon against the United States. According to that letter, the idea of ​​using the cartel to flood the United States with cocaine came from the Cuban regime. Carvajal was head of intelligence and counterintelligence for Chávez and Maduro. Carvajal is awaiting sentencing in a federal prison after pleading guilty to drug trafficking.
